FACTS Launches Data Insights, Redefining How Schools Turn Information into Action

LINCOLN, Neb., Jan. 8, 2026 /PRNewswire/ — FACTS, a leading provider of education technology solutions supporting school administration, financial management, and family engagement, announced the launch of FACTS Data Insights. The new analytics experience brings school data together into a single, connected view, enabling leaders to better understand performance and drive school success.

FACTS Data Insights delivers centralized, visual dashboards that unify enrollment, financial, and student trends across FACTS solutions, giving schools instant visibility without the need to run multiple reports or reconcile fragmented data. Built natively into the FACTS ecosystem, Data Insights enables school leaders to:

  • View student and financial performance across all FACTS systems in one place and communicate outcomes easily to boards, leadership teams, and stakeholders
  • Monitor enrollment health and retention through expert-built dashboards that highlight trends and risk indicators
  • Drill into specific schools or cohorts to explore patterns and opportunities
  • Support strategic planning, resource allocation, and school improvement efforts

The initial release of FACTS Data Insights is available to existing FACTS customers at no additional charge and schools can begin exploring dashboards immediately to gain new visibility into the metrics that matter most.

About FACTS

FACTS, a Nelnet company, provides mission-critical education technology solutions that strengthen operational efficiency, financial management, enrollment, tuition administration, and family engagement for schools worldwide. Serving more than 12,000 organizations and over 4 million learners, FACTS provides a comprehensive suite of edtech and fintech products designed to simplify school operations while connecting schools and families through experiences built on trust, insight, and impact. UK Looks to US to Adopt More Crypto-Friendly Approach

The UK and US are reportedly preparing to deepen cooperation on digital assets, with Britain looking to copy the Trump administration’s crypto-friendly stance in a bid to boost innovation.  UK Chancellor Rachel Reeves and US Treasury Secretary Scott Bessent discussed on Tuesday how the two nations could strengthen their coordination on crypto, the Financial Times reported on Tuesday, citing people familiar with the matter.  The discussions also involved representatives from crypto companies, including Coinbase, Circle Internet Group and Ripple, with executives from the Bank of America, Barclays and Citi also attending, according to the report. The agreement was made “last-minute” after crypto advocacy groups urged the UK government on Thursday to adopt a more open stance toward the industry, claiming its cautious approach to the sector has left the country lagging in innovation and policy.  Source: Rachel Reeves Deal to include stablecoins, look to unlock adoption Any deal between the countries is likely to include stablecoins, the Financial Times reported, an area of crypto that US President Donald Trump made a policy priority and in which his family has significant business interests. The Financial Times reported on Monday that UK crypto advocacy groups also slammed the Bank of England’s proposal to limit individual stablecoin holdings to between 10,000 British pounds ($13,650) and 20,000 pounds ($27,300), claiming it would be difficult and expensive to implement. UK banks appear to have slowed adoption too, with around 40% of 2,000 recently surveyed crypto investors saying that their banks had either blocked or delayed a payment to a crypto provider.  Many of these actions have been linked to concerns over volatility, fraud and scams.
